在计算机编程领域中,程序语言是用来编写程序的一种形式化语言。程序语言是计算机可以理解和处理的一种语 法结构,它包括单词、符号和规则,用来表示计算机内部处理的算法和数据结构。为了更好的进行程序设计,我们需要选择一种合适的程序设计语言。
1.面向过程程序设计语言
面向过程的程序设计语言主要解决的问题是按顺序执行一系列指令,并且将数据和执行方法结合起来,通过数据和方法的结合来达到程序的目标。C语言是最为著名的面向过程程序设计语言之一,它具有执行效率高、使用范围广的特点,广泛应用于操作系统、网络通信等领域。
2.面向对象程序设计语言
面向对象的程序语言将问题和数据结构封装成对象,通过方法来操纵这些对象。Java是最为著名的面向对象程序设计语言之一,它具有强大的移植性和多线程等优点,广泛应用于移动端、大型企业应用等领域。
3.函数式编程语言
函数式编程语言是一种基于数学理论的编程范型,它主要使用函数来进行程序设计。函数式编程语言具有代码简洁、高可读性等优点。Haskell是最为著名的函数式编程语言之一,它被广泛应用于理论计算机科学领域。
4.自然语言编程
自然语言编程是一种语言计算机界面的编程方式,它可以使用人们自然语言进行编程,在编程的同时提高语言的的能力。自然语言编程目前仍处于发展初期,未来将有着广泛的应用场景。
总之,在程序设计语言的选择中需要根据程序设计的具体需求和特点来进行不同程序设计语言的选择,以达到更好的程序设计效果。
扫码领取最新备考资料